Chapter 1.1: Awakening
The sun rose over the peaceful village of Kiro, casting a gentle glow on the tranquil streets. Kyra Himito, a spirited and quick-witted young woman, awoke from a restless night filled with unsettling nightmares. Her heart raced, and beads of sweat dotted her forehead as she gasped for breath, struggling to calm the waves of panic crashing over her.
Slowly, Kyra sat up, clutching her chest as she attempted to regain control of her racing thoughts. The memories from her past life, like flickering shadows, taunted her mind. It was a haunting realization that she had died before, and the weight of that revelation pressed heavily upon her fragile psyche.
Her breaths came in short, rapid bursts as she began to hyperventilate, overwhelmed by the flood of fragmented memories. The room spun around her, and her vision blurred as a wave of dizziness washed over her. Unable to bear the intensity of her emotions, Kyra succumbed to the overwhelming weight of her past and lost consciousness.
When Kyra eventually regained consciousness, her eyes fluttered open, her surroundings blurry and disorienting. As her vision cleared, she found herself lying on a soft bed, the gentle glow of sunlight filtering through the window. In a desperate attempt to calm her racing heart, she whispered soothing words to herself, but to her shock, her voice sounded unfamiliar—different in tone and resonance.
The realization struck her like a lightning bolt. Her voice, once familiar and comforting, now possessed an otherworldly quality. It carried a hauntingly melodic timbre that seemed to echo through the very depths of her being. Kyra's heart clenched with a mix of fear and curiosity. What had happened to her? How had her voice changed so dramatically?
She was consumed by worry, her mind racing with questions and uncertainties. What could this mean? Was it some kind of power that had been dormant within her, now awakened by her past life's memories?
Interrupting her thoughts, Kyra's mother called from downstairs, impatiently urging her to come down for breakfast. The distraction provided a momentary reprieve from the overwhelming emotions that swirled within her.
Taking a deep breath, Kyra composed herself and made her way to the kitchen, where the comforting aroma of freshly cooked pancakes enveloped the air. Her mother greeted her with a warm smile, unaware of the incredible changes that had taken place within her daughter overnight.
"Good morning, sweetie," her mother said, setting a plate of pancakes on the table. "Sit down and join us for breakfast."
Kyra forced a smile, trying to hide her inner turmoil. As she settled into her seat at the table, uncertainty gnawed at her. She hesitantly picked up her fork, eying the pancakes before taking a bite. The flavors were familiar, but there was an underlying tension that tainted the simple act of eating.
Midway through her meal, Kyra's voice betrayed her once again. She couldn't ignore the newfound enchantment that seemed to weave through her words. Her voice carried a captivating quality, captivating even herself as she spoke.
"Mum, have you noticed anything different about my voice?" Kyra asked, her voice betraying a mixture of curiosity and concern.
Her mother looked at her quizzically, setting her own fork down. "Different? Well, now that you mention it, there's something uniquely captivating about it. It's as if each word you speak holds a certain charm."
Kyra's eyes widened, her heart pounding. An idea sparked within her. She leaned closer to her mother, a mischievous glimmer in her eyes.
"Watch this," Kyra whispered, her voice infused with a subtle energy.
She cleared her throat and began speaking, weaving a tale filled with whimsy and humor. As she continued, her words danced through the air, wrapping around her mother like a gentle embrace. A smile spread across her mother's face, and a soft giggle escaped her lips.
"What a marvelous story, Kyra," her mother said, her eyes sparkling with delight. "Your voice truly has a magical quality to it."
Kyra's heart soared with joy and relief. Her voice had the power to bring happiness and enchantment to those she cared about. She realized that this gift could be used not only for her own self-discovery but also to brighten the lives of others.
And so, with a newfound sense of purpose, Kyra Himito embraced her altered voice and the possibilities it held. As she contemplated the extent of her newfound power, a man's voice resonated within her mind, accompanied by a faint background music that added to the mysterious atmosphere. "With great power comes great responsibility," the voice declared, echoing through the depths of her consciousness.
